Let's delve into the history and concepts behind medical electronic device registration. ### History of Medical Electronic Device Registration The regulation of medical devices dates back several decades, with the recognition of the need to establish standards for safety and efficacy. In the United States, the Medical Device Amendments of 1976 introduced regulatory oversight by the Food and Drug Administration (FDA), requiring medical devices to be classified based on the level of control necessary to assure their safety and effectiveness. As technology continued to evolve, the FDA updated its regulations to keep pace with advancements in medical electronic devices. In 2002, the Medical Device User Fee and Modernization Act (MDUFMA) enhanced the review process for new devices, emphasizing the importance of premarket notification, also known as 510(k) clearance, and premarket approval applications. ### Definition and Concept Clarification Medical electronic device registration entails the formal process of submitting necessary documentation and information to regulatory authorities, such as the FDA in the US or the European Medicines Agency (EMA) in the EU, to obtain approval or clearance for the marketing and distribution of these devices. This process is designed to assess the safety, efficacy, and quality of the device, ensuring that it meets established standards and regulations. Key aspects of medical electronic device registration include: 1. **Classification:** Devices are categorized based on risk, with higher-risk devices requiring more stringent review processes. 2. **Premarket Approval:** Some devices necessitate premarket approval, which involves comprehensive scientific review to evaluate safety and effectiveness. 3. **Quality System Regulation:** Compliance with quality system regulations is essential to demonstrate that devices are manufactured under controlled conditions to ensure consistency and quality. 4. **Postmarket Surveillance:** Monitoring the performance of devices on the market to identify and address any safety concerns or issues that may arise.
